Position Overview & Compensation

The Part-Time Educator role at lululemon offers a pay range between $20.25 and $25.30 per hour, plus target bonuses and excellent benefits.

This position is part-time and includes flexible hours, including evenings, weekends, and holidays, ideal for those needing schedule adaptability.

Applicants must be 18 or older and legally allowed to work in their area, embracing an inclusive and dynamic retail environment.

Benefits include health plans, paid time off, generous discounts, wellness programs, and personal development resources.

lululemon’s pay-for-performance culture further motivates employees through competitive bonuses and recognition.

What to Expect Daily

The core duty of a Part-Time Educator is to provide top-notch guest experiences through engagement, product education, and responsive service.

Tasks involve facilitating in-store and online purchases, managing returns, and ensuring a seamless shopping journey for every guest.

Teamwork is central: collaboration with colleagues ensures smooth operations and outstanding customer care at every shift.

Store upkeep is shared, including restocking, product presentation, and maintaining the clean, high-end atmosphere lululemon is known for.

Using in-store technology and upholding safety protocols are essential, ensuring a positive and secure workplace for everyone.

Potential Downsides

Some may find the pace demanding, with constant guest interaction and movement on the sales floor.

Shifts can include evenings, weekends, and holidays, which may not fit everyone’s preferences or personal schedules.

Lifting boxes (up to 13.6 kg) and long periods walking or standing are required, so physical stamina is important.

The environment features bright lights and lively music, which may not suit those seeking a quieter workspace.

Those looking for strictly remote or desk-based roles may find the hands-on, active expectations challenging.
